Abstract
Establishing a business such as a convenience store in the Philippine Industry is important
as it localizes economies, practices inclusivity, respects culture and tradition, has a strong
commitment, and has a healthy mindset to serve its customers. It is also important to apply ethics
when running a business, as it helps business people make appropriate decisions. This study aimed
to discover the business ethics and importance of the industry of convenience stores in the
Philippines. This study used archival data and data mining as part of its methodology; it examined
enormous amounts of data in order to find relevant research that could sustain this research paper.
Business ethics as applied to convenience stores are important for helping the business boost its
sales and serve its consumers. This paper identified that both business people and consumers fulfill
their duties in the market. Discerning the importance of business ethics allows people to do what
they want as customers and also helps them make good decisions. Convenience stores, on the other
hand, contribute to the economic growth of the Philippines and provide convenience to their
customers.

Keywords: Business Ethics; Convenience Store; and Economy.

Discussion

Localize Economies
Discerning the importance of building convenience stores in a localize economies is
beneficial to the people within the industry. Vishwanath, V., & Rigby, D. K. (2006) vii stresses that
the communities of market consumers are rapidly increasing and becoming more diverse in terms
of lifestyle, ethnicity, wealth, values, and lifestyle. In line with the growing consumer markets,
retailers such as convenience stores are now customizing their products and offering them to
different local markets, the development of various store types, and alternate approaches when it
comes to the pricing, staffing, marketing, and customer service in order to connect with its

customers, and this emphasizes how convenience stores are shifting from standardization to
localization.

The operation of convenience store in a local area in the Philippines, will not only help the
business to gain its network but it will serve the consumers. According to the study of Soewignyo,
F. (2010)viii time and place should be systematically equated so customers will benefit from the
availability and the convenience of having a store since it the store provides a customer-focused
service. This will help the business to connect with a larger community for providing a well-
sustained convenience store that will help them to have a good relationship with consumers and
have a good image among the majority.

It is crucial to comprehend how to connect with the community and how the operation
of a convenience store will contribute to the economy. Emphasizing the importance of an
advantageous connection between the company and its customers will be beneficial in ensuring
the efficient functioning of the business as well help to the business grow and have more products
to offer to consumers.

Commitment
Conte, E. D. (2017) xiv stresses that in convenience stores, prevention of losses and
managing inventory starts at the top, with specific regulations and guidelines for employees and
store management, followed by accountability for mistakes. It is critical to practice in order to run
a successful business. Problems can be avoided by being adequately educated and prepared to run
a business. Accountability enables a manager to quickly identify minor changes in product
movement, shortfalls and overruns, or variations in sales patterns and correct the cause.

According to Economic growth in the Philippines creating retail opportunities (2017) xv


with growth extending across all subsectors of the retailing industry as one, groceries and
convenience stores continue to be the ones with the biggest effect on the country's economy
because of to the category's more diverse products and services of every day necessities, that fulfill
a large proportion of Filipino consumers' consumption needs. As thus, retailers continue strongly
committed to boosting accessibility and product diversity for goods such as beauty and personal
care, home care products, food and beverages, and more.
